David Stras joined the faculty of the University of Minnesota Law School in 2004. He teaches and writes in the areas of federal courts and jurisdiction, constitutional law, criminal law, civil rights, federal habeas corpus, law and politics, and law and economics. His current research focuses on the federal judiciary and the Supreme Court of the United States. Using a variety of methodological tools, including empirical and historical analyses, Professor Stras's research has examined a variety of issues relating to the Supreme Court. Professor Stras is a frequent television and radio commentator on issues relating to the federal judiciary, particularly with respect to the Supreme Court of the United States. He is also an adjunct faculty member of the University of Minnesota Political Science Department, and is the co-editor of a new SSRN journal on "Law and Politics." Professor Stras also recently became a co-director of the Institute for Law and Politics at the University of Minnesota.
